It’s common knowledge that sleeping away from home can raise the risk of bed bugs. While they don’t carry diseases, bed bugs are still some of the most frustrating insects to deal with. Their bites can lead to swelling, irritation, and sleepless nights. For some, the reaction can include rash-like symptoms or even mild skin infections. In most cases, the Brown Recluse you’ll find in Crossville, AL isn’t very large. On average, the brown recluse measures between 0.5 to 1 inch in size. It can be identified by its distinct brown color and the dark stripe running down its back. Many describe that this stripe resembles the shape of a fiddle, which is why the brown recluse is often called the fiddleback spider.
